Output 43d3ee0d92de5d19a43dcc064dffb1c3d10b7d48abe4bbd875be655aed9c062a:0

value
34875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be7b7b2007ff0e866fc7639a8698e2c7625986f OP_EQUAL
address
379mNszmhHajLhMpQTHoqXjnybqWVcmLDB
transaction
43d3ee0d92de5d19a43dcc064dffb1c3d10b7d48abe4bbd875be655aed9c062a
confirmations
255566
spent
true